Level 384 is the 385th level of the Backrooms,
Description
Level 384, nicknamed as “The Blue Couch Rooms”, consists of non-linear rooms with blue couches that are present in this level, hence the name of The Blue Couch Rooms.
The level is estimated to be approximately 500 miles in diameter. Anything beyond that area is considered as Level -384. The blue couches spawn after 50 yards. The floor are ceramic tiles and often they reflect 100% of light, these tiles are called, “Mirror Tiles”. Random items might appear on the blue couches. The following items that can spawn are: A children’s school bag, a drawing, a mirror, a box of packaged almond water, and a cafeteria tray with edible food on it, etc.
This level is also almost impossible to take a clear picture or a video on it. Trying to take a photo will result the photo being super blurry or static, if one decided to film a video, the recording device will instantly break and impossible to use until leaving Level 384. Avoid looking at the mirror tiles that are near windows directly, they might temporarily blind you. The only entities are The Disease and Facelings. The Disease are only found in a laboratory-like tubes inside some of the school bags. The Facelings in this level are very friendly and only attack if you kill one of them. They also help anyone to go to the “Promised Land” or back to the reality
